"We did very well," said CMU head coach Jim Ray Kluck. "Jacob Williams, who we had playing in our four spot shoots a 143 total for two days, which is an excellent score. Nick Phelps had a very good tournament as well. He improved his score by five strokes on the second day. We are a pretty good team."
�
Other schools that participated in the invite included Baker University, Crowley Ridge College, Evangel University, and William Penn University.
�
Jacob Williams led CMU on day one with a 70, and he backed that score up with a second best 73 for CMU on Wednesday. Nick Phelps who finished tied for second in the invite, fired a round of 71 on Wednesday; which was the lowest round by an Eagle.
�
Brendan Ross fired a 74 on day two to finish in sixth place for the invite. While Isaac Burroughs and Greg Pitzer finished in 15th and 25th respectively. As a team, CMU held on to defeat William Penn 595 to 596. Evangel University took a close third with a total score of 599.
�
CMU's "B" team consisted of Eric Vanderlinden, Jordan Haag, Tyler Steger, Davis Johnson, and Brody Lehenbauer.
�
The Eagle men are next in action on October 5th and 6th, when they travel to Columbia to take part in the Columbia College Fall Invitational.
